Hello,
I just purchased a 2000 CAT E6000I GC30K Forklift. Runs great, turns great. No smoke. However, it lacks power to drive up a small incline ramp or get over a bump. Also, i have to rev up the rpms to lift the forks, or make it over the small bump.

Any suggestions plan of attack? Should I start with the propane system clean (carb, filters, diaphragm) or not sure if it has an inch valve or disconnect valve.

Please advise.
